Wow--I would need 2 hours to answer well. But, as a start, consider this routing. From Salamanca, go to Cuidad Rodrigo, then Caceres, then Marvao to stay at the Pousada. Then Estromoz and Evora. It gets tough after that--probably thru Begar to Andalusia and Seville. If time permits, consider Lagos and the Cape at Sagres--the Pousada there is great. On you way to Barcelona try to hit Nerja and Peniscola on the coast. Sorry, the question is very big.
